Hair care retail franchise Price Attack held its 2010 national conference in Fiji and invited former Prime Minister John Howard to address the delegates.

Howard praised the optimisim of the franchisees. “It brought together numerous men and women who are competitive small business operators. If the spirit I encountered at the conference is reflected throughout the franchise it should be very successful.”

The weekÕs schedule included a supplier trade show, educational presentations and the business awards event that acknowledges the key drivers of the Price Attack brand.

Price Attack multi-unit franchisees Simon and Leanne Finlay took out the Franchisee of the Year award. The Finlay husband and wife team have two South Australian stores at Tea Tree Plaza and Ingle Farm, and a third in Casuarina Square, Northern Territory.

Managing director Barry Jarred said “Simon and Leanne Finlay consistently strive for the highest standards and achieve excellence in all areas of the business. Getting one business system right is a challenge and here we have a family that is operating three stores in a hard retail environment and itÕs simply outstanding.”

Salon basin-partner Matrix will provide the couple with a $1000 marketing solutions voucher to further maximize their business potential.

The franchise chain also used the conference to announce business developments including an exclusive professional hair care label, the biggest investment in a Christmas promotion, and the introduction of a Trade Card for home hairdressers.
